Web28 sep. 2024 · One of the simplest and most effective ways to fix this issue is to reconnect your AC adapter and your laptop battery. To do so: 1) Power off your laptop. 2) Unplug the AC adapter and the battery from your laptop. 3) Press and hold the power button on your laptop for 20 seconds to release the residual power in you laptop. 4) Re-connect the ... Web22 okt. 2024 · The first thing you should do if a laptop does not turn on is to check the LED light. Depending on the model of your Dell laptop, LED could be located either on the sides or the front side of your laptop. Press the power button and check if the LED turns on.
